Opinion is a person's opinion or thought regarding a problem that is currently occurring in society. An opinion must pay attention to the effectiveness of the sentence so that the reader can capture its contents. Therefore, this study will focus on the effectiveness of a sentence in a collection of opinions. This study was conducted to describe the effectiveness of sentences in a collection of opinions as critical reading teaching materials. This type of study is qualitative with a descriptive method; the technique for collecting data is using the listening and note-taking technique. The results of this study indicate that there are still several sentences that are not effective, so that readers have difficulty capturing their contents properly. Effective sentences meet requirements such as the economy of words, commensurate structure, logical language, and careful reasoning. Meanwhile, ineffective sentences occur because the structure of the sentence does not show unity, is wasteful of words or long-winded explanations, and lacks clarity in conveying information. The benefits of this study, in practice, are that it makes it easier for readers to determine the effectiveness of sentences in a collection of opinions. This study took data in the form of ineffective sentences contained in a collection of opinions for statistical literacy, the November 2024 edition of critical reading teaching materials for high school students.

This study aims to analyze the abilities and challenges of grade IV elementary school students in writing argumentative sentences. The research was conducted with a qualitative approach of case study methods on ten students in one of the public elementary schools in Jambi City. Data were obtained through an argumentative sentence writing test and analyzed using the Miles and Huberman model which includes data reduction, data presentation, and verification. The results of the study show that students' ability to write argumentative sentences still varies. Most of the students have been able to convey their opinions in a concise and relevant manner, but there are still obstacles in the mechanical aspects of writing such as the use of spelling, punctuation, and sentence structure. These findings show the need for a learning strategy that can develop argumentative writing skills systematically and logically. Toulmin's pattern-based approach and collaborative learning models such as Group Investigation are recommended to improve students' overall argumentative writing skills from the elementary school level.

Mathematics is often referred to as a field of knowledge developed through logical reasoning and is considered essential in everyday life, particularly in problem-solving. One effective way to apply problem-solving skills in mathematics education is through the use of word problems. This study aims to explore and analyze the various obstacles students encounter when solving mathematical word problems. The research employs a descriptive qualitative approach, with data collection methods including tests, interviews, and a project involving the construction of a staircase using standard units of length. The subjects of the study were four third-grade elementary school students in Batusangkar who had previously studied standard units of length. The findings reveal that students faced a range of difficulties, such as challenges in understanding the problems, failure to organize solution steps systematically, and limited comprehension of the concept of standard measurement units. Additionally, a lack of interest in learning was found to negatively impact students’ ability to solve word problems. Therefore, conceptual understanding and increased motivation to learn are crucial factors in enhancing students’ mathematical problem-solving abilities.

Algorithms and programming play a crucial role in problem solving and software development. The origin of the word "algorithm" comes from "algorism," and its history can be traced to Abu Ja'far Muhammad Ibn Musa Al-khuwarizmi. This article presents definitions of algorithms from several sources, such as Kani (2020), Jando &; Nani (2018), Munir & Lidya (2016), and Sismoro (2005). The programming algorithm, as a series of logical and systematic steps, becomes the core in Troubleshooting. The research method applied is descriptive and qualitative, by collecting information from various sources, including books, journal articles, and research reports. The discussion in this article covers the significance of algorithms in everyday life and their application in computer programming. In addition, this article details the basic concepts of algorithms, the role of programming languages, and algorithm representation techniques. In the discussion section, it was revealed that algorithms involve logical and systematic steps to solve a task or problem. The basic structure of the algorithm includes repetition, branching, and sequential order. Programming languages contribute to simplifying human interaction with computers, increasing productivity, as well as facilitating software maintenance and development. Algorithms can be represented in the form of descriptive sentences, pseudocode, or flowcharts. Flowcharts use symbols to illustrate the steps of solving a problem. Repetition, branching, and sequential structures can be clearly described through flowcharts. This article provides a comprehensive overview of algorithms and programming, giving readers insight into the basic concepts, implementation, and importance of algorithms in the context of computer programming.
